Amebic liver abscess
Alternate Names : Hepatic amebiasis, Extraintestinal amebiasis, Abscess - amebic liver
Symptoms & Signs
There may or may not be symptoms of intestinal infection. Symptoms may include: - Abdominal pain
- Particularly in the right, upper part of the abdomen
- Intense, continuous, or stabbing pain
- Chills
- Diarrhea
- Fever
- General discomfort, uneasiness, or ill feeling (malaise)
- Jaundice
- Joint pain
- Loss of appetite
- Sweating
- Weight loss
